Amanda Wolf
Amanda Wolf is in her fourth year as an assistant athletic trainer at the College of the Holy Cross. She serves as the day-to-day athletic trainer for the Crusader women's basketball, field hockey and softball teams, in addition to providing support for a number of other varsity sports. From 2002-2004, Wolf served as a graduate assistant athletic trainer for the University of Massachusetts at Amherst. She worked with the UMass softball and football teams, in addition to serving as an athletic trainer for UMass sports camps in the summer of 2003. Wolf was previously a student athletic trainer at Towson University from 1998-2001, and served as an intern athletic trainer at the Gilman School in Baltimore, Md., in the spring of 2002. Wolf earned her bachelor's degree in athletic training from Towson University in 2002. She went on to receive a master's degree in exercise science from the University of Massachusetts in 2004. |
